5 Steps To Create The Perfect Holiday Party Invitations:
1. Pick a date:
To me, weekends work better, preferably a Saturday or Sunday. I recommend having a Christmas party at least one week before Christmas.
2 Determine a guest list/party size:
Do you want to keep it small and just invite close friends and family, or do you want to invite your whole neighborhood?
3. Type of event:
Do you want a formal Christmas dinner, a cookie exchange, a hot chocolate social, a neighborhood potluck, or a New Year’s Eve celebration? The options are endless. Based on how many people you want to attend, you can pick the type of event from there.

5. Mailing Them Out:
In order to give your guest as much planning time as possible, you should send the invites out 2-4 weeks in advance.
